Senior Machine Learning Manager Ads Campaign Optimization
Apple, Cupertino, California, United States, 95014
Senior Machine Learning Manager
Ads Campaign Optimization
Cupertino, California, United States Machine Learning and AI At Apple, we strive every day to create products that enrich people's lives. Our Advertising Platforms group enables users worldwide to discover new content seamlessly while empowering publishers and developers to promote and monetize their work. Our technology powers advertising in the App Store and Apple News, delivering highly-performant, privacy-first solutions that set new industry standards. We're seeking an adventurous and strategic leader to drive innovation in Ads Campaign Optimization. This role requires a deep understanding of Ad network behavior and the ability to develop and prioritize an innovation roadmap that spans multiple technical domains. You'll lead a team that designs, develops, and delivers innovative capabilities, differentiating Apple's Ad Platforms and driving key business outcomes. Minimum Qualifications
7+ years of experience leading teams that apply advanced statistical/ML methods to large, sophisticated datasets. Track record of leading engineering teams from design to implementation, ensuring scalability and reliability. Deep mathematical understanding of modern ML techniques, including linear algebra and statistics. Experience working with operational teams on deployment, monitoring, and system management. Strong analytical skills, ability to investigate multiple streams of ad quality data, draw insights, and recommend actionable solutions. Experience in one or more of the following domains: Algorithms, Architecture, AI, Database Systems, Data Mining, Distributed Systems, Machine Learning, Networking, Statistics, Game Theory, Auction Design, Quantitative Analysis, or Systems Software implementation. Hands-on experience with Python or Java in a production environment. Proficiency in databases, SQL, and scripting languages for data processing and model deployment. BS, or equivalent experience, in AI, ML, Mathematics, Computer Science, or a related field Preferred Qualifications
10+ years of experience leading teams that apply advanced statistical/ML methods to large, sophisticated datasets. MS/PhD, or equivalent experience, in AI, ML, Mathematics, Computer Science, or a related field. Previous experience with online advertising domain highly preferred. Pay & Benefits
At Apple, base pay is one part of our total compensation package and is determined within a range. This provides the opportunity to progress as you grow and develop within a role. The base pay range for this role is between $198,300 and $342,800, and your base pay will depend on your skills, qualifications, experience, and location. Apple employees also have the opportunity to become an Apple shareholder through participation in Apple's discretionary employee stock programs. Apple employees are eligible for discretionary restricted stock unit awards, and can purchase Apple stock at a discount if voluntarily participating in Apple's Employee Stock Purchase Plan. You'll also receive benefits including: Comprehensive medical and dental coverage, retirement benefits, a range of discounted products and free services, and for formal education related to advancing your career at Apple, reimbursement for certain educational expenses
including tuition. Additionally, this role might be eligible for discretionary bonuses or commission payments as well as relocation.
